Marco Maria Scuderi is a scholar working on Geophysics, Mechanics of Materials and Ocean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Marco Maria Scuderi has authored 55 papers receiving a total of 2.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 49 papers in Geophysics, 17 papers in Mechanics of Materials and 6 papers in Ocean Engineering. Recurrent topics in Marco Maria Scuderi’s work include earthquake and tectonic studies (44 papers), High-pressure geophysics and materials (35 papers) and Geological and Geochemical Analysis (17 papers). Marco Maria Scuderi is often cited by papers focused on earthquake and tectonic studies (44 papers), High-pressure geophysics and materials (35 papers) and Geological and Geochemical Analysis (17 papers). Marco Maria Scuderi collaborates with scholars based in Italy, United States and Switzerland. Marco Maria Scuderi's co-authors include Cristiano Collettini, Chris Marone, B. M. Carpenter, D. M. Saffer, J. R. Leeman, Elisa Tinti, Cecilia Viti, Telemaco Tesei, Giuseppe Di Stefano and Frédéric Cappa and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ature Communications, Earth and Planetary Science Letters and Scientific Reports.
